Paniculata or tall phlox, is a native American wildflower that is native from New York to Iowa south to Georgia, Mississippi and Arkansas. It blooms from July to September. Creeping phlox spreads rapidly and makes great ground cover. [ 4] It can be planted to cover banks, fill spaces under tall trees, and spill and trail over slopes.

Akebia quinata –commonly known as chocolate vine, five-leaf chocolate vine, [ 1] or five-leaf akebia – is a shrub that is native to Japan, China and Korea, commonly used as an ornamental / edible plant in the United States and Europe.
